Job Description: The Public Health Nurse (PHN), as an integral member of the Public Health Services team, provides nursing services within the framework of the Population Health Promotion Model and Primary Health Care. This employee works relatively independently and is expected to make primary decisions based on sound assessments in accordance with The Public Health Act, the policies of the Public Health Nursing program, the SRNA Standards of Practice, the Canadian Community Health Nursing Standards of Practice, and other relevant legislation. Inherent in this role are knowledge, skills, and abilities specific to health promotion, prevention, and protection. This employee liases with, and refers to, other health personnel, and other sectors and community groups.
